Box Score (LEBANON, Ill., Feb. 21)- The McKendree University women's basketball team lost a Great Lakes Valley Conference contest to No. 2 Lewis University on Saturday 91-71. Prior to the game, the Bearcats honored seniors
Caty Ponce (Edwardsville, Ill./Edwardsville) and
Haeley Kreisel (Warsaw, Mo./Warsaw).
McKendree falls to 2-23 overall and 1-16 in GLVC and will host University of Illinois Springfield on Thursday, Feb. 26 for the season finale at 5:30 p.m.
Sophomore forward
Emily Pusheck (South Milwaukee, Wis./South Milwaukee) led four Bearcat players in double-figures with a career-high 18 points. Sophomore forward
Gabrielle Williams (Minooka, Ill./Plainfield East) added 17 points, while Ponce and sophomore forward
Ellie Pusheck (South Milwaukee, Wis./South Milwaukee) each scored 10 points. Ponce also had a career-high eight assists.
McKendree battled back-and-forth with the Flyers in the opening half, but could not find its range from downtown with no three's in the first half to trail 48-34 at the break. Lewis only made one more shot from the field than the Bearcats in the second half, but McKendree only made two of its nine three-point attempts in the second half and were unable to cut into the deficit in the loss.
